What does daily life look like in terms of housing search, food options, transport, and errands?
Daily life in Sarajevo blends affordability with rich local offerings. When you search for housing, start in Centar, Marijin Dvor, or Novo Sarajevo for convenience, then explore Bistrik or Alipasino Polje for better value. Food options range from bustling pijace (markets) and bakeries to traditional cevabdzinice, often delivering good quality at low costs. Public transport, including trams, buses, and occasional taxis, covers the city well and helps you move without a car. For coworking and errands, look for shared spaces near your residence and local libraries. Sarajevo living cost can shift with seasonality, so build a flexible weekly plan and keep a small buffer for surprises. Tip: use transit passes and time your grocery runs to market days.
How can you think about quality of life, budgeting, and neighborhood fit to maximize daily comfort?
Quality of life in Sarajevo rewards those who build a practical budgeting framework and choose a neighborhood that fits your rhythm. Start with a simple plan: housing and utilities, groceries and eating out, transport, and personal spend, then adjust with the seasons. In winter, you will notice cooling/heating needs and perhaps more indoor activities; in summer, outdoor cafes and events pick up. For saving, favor homes with good insulation, cook at home, and buy seasonal produce from markets. Neighborhood fit matters: Old Town offers walkability and culture, while newer districts can offer quieter streets and lower rents. Tip: try a three-month trial of a few areas to gauge daily rhythms and safety.
